HIV Combo Test Negative After Exposure To HIV. Can I Consider This Conclusive?
HI Doc. Greetings from India. To be brief my question is after 8 weeks of my potential exposure to HIV I had an HIV COMBO test ( antibody and antigen ). It was negative. can I consider this conclusive? Thank you very much. (My exposure was protected sex but I forgot check condom and frottage where vaginal fluids touched my penis tip)
Hi and welcome to HCM.Thanks for the query. Yes it is conclusive after 8 weeks. I dont see a reason to repeat the tests unless for your own satisfaction Wish you good health. Regards
